Understanding Partnership Dissolution

Partnership dissolution involves winding up affairs, settling ownership, and addressing ongoing obligations to clients, lenders, and employees.

We help you explore options such as buyouts, mediation, and, if needed, court action to resolve issues.

Definition and Explanation

Partnership dissolution is a formal process to terminate a business relationship, allocate assets and liabilities, and document settlements between partners.

Key Elements and Processes

Key elements include reviewing the partnership agreement, valuing interests, agreeing on buyout terms, distributing assets, and preparing the necessary documents.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ary of terms used in dissolving partnerships to help you understand the process.

Partnership Agreement

A contract that outlines each partner’s rights duties profit sharing and the procedures for dissolution.

Valuation

Process of determining each partner’s share of the business value for buyouts and settlements.

Buyout

An arrangement to purchase a departing partner’s interest, often based on fair market value.

Liquidation

Selling off assets to settle debts and distribute remaining assets.

What is partnership dissolution?

Partnership dissolution involves winding up operations, distributing assets, and settling liabilities in accordance with the partnership agreement and California law. This process also requires clear communication with all partners and stakeholders to minimize disruption and protect ongoing obligations. Mediation can resolve disputes without court action, preserving relationships and reducing costs. It is often a preferred first step before pursuing litigation.

Dissolution allocates assets and settles debts according to the partnership agreement and law. Final distributions should be documented to avoid later disputes.

A well-structured buyout protects interests by defining terms and ensuring payment. This reduces risk and provides a clearer path for exit.

Valuation determines each partner’s share of the business value for buyouts and exits, affecting future control and finances. Accurate methods support fair negotiations.

An attorney helps interpret terms, coordinate documents, and represent you in negotiations or litigation. This can streamline the process and protect your rights.

Buyout calculations consider assets, liabilities, and the chosen valuation method. Common approaches include capital account, asset-based, or independent appraisal.
